I was finally able to upgrade to Fink 0.4.1, but not 
without a potential problem. After I upgraded to the new 
fink package manager 0.10.0, fink insisted on trying to 
download (and I presume compile) the latest versions 
of all my installed packages,and I was finally able to 
terminate this process. I don't want to compile from 
sources; I prefer to work with apt-get and binary 
packages only (I'm still running OS 10.1.5). So now, I 
see that many of my installed packages have updates 
available. So now, my question is how do I selectively 
update packages witn apt-get without having to update 
them all?
